Output 2dd5105385acf150b17ea0d209601361381d0b3060b9a2d9de0551343fb9151b:11

value
12068662
script pubkey
OP_0 OP_PUSHBYTES_32 580d3a510aa64c387338a9d5e915d4bd694d7b0e0b05caa68372f5367904adc1
address
bc1qtqxn55g25exrsuec4827j9w5h45567cwpvzu4f5rwt6nv7gy4hqsdt2j3g
transaction
2dd5105385acf150b17ea0d209601361381d0b3060b9a2d9de0551343fb9151b
spent
true